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
384674 27432 601 8522605206 8357747594
462606 484 616938089
462606 484 616938089
34 687555 61416295
All about undefined
Interested in learning more?
462606 484 616938089
34 687555 61416295
See more
578 57
44833 7363872135 780079680 5190
See more
2748 9653162 351
121 627868 95881774710 45413
See more